黑狐家游戏

多云管理开源软件有哪些平台,开源视角,盘点多云管理领域的明星平台及解决方案

欧气 1 0

本文目录导读:

  1. Kubernetes
  2. OpenStack
  3. Terraform
  4. Ansible

在数字化转型的浪潮下,多云管理已经成为企业IT架构的重要组成部分,开源软件以其灵活性、可定制性和成本优势,成为了多云管理领域的重要选择,本文将为您盘点多云管理领域的开源软件平台,并分析它们的优势与特点。

Kubernetes

Kubernetes(简称K8s)是Google开源的容器编排平台,旨在实现容器化应用的自动化部署、扩展和管理,Kubernetes支持跨多个云平台和本地环境,成为多云管理领域的明星平台。

多云管理开源软件有哪些平台,开源视角,盘点多云管理领域的明星平台及解决方案

图片来源于网络,如有侵权联系删除

1、优势:

(1)高度可扩展:Kubernetes支持大规模集群部署,可轻松扩展至数千个节点。

(2)跨平台支持:Kubernetes支持主流云平台,如阿里云、腾讯云、华为云等。

(3)容器化技术:Kubernetes基于容器技术,简化了应用部署和管理。

2、特点:

(1)声明式API:Kubernetes使用声明式API,便于自动化管理和监控。

(2)资源管理:Kubernetes提供丰富的资源管理功能,如CPU、内存、存储等。

(3)负载均衡:Kubernetes支持自动负载均衡,提高应用可用性。

OpenStack

OpenStack是由Rackspace和NASA共同发起的开源云计算平台,旨在为用户提供灵活、可扩展的云基础设施,OpenStack在多云管理领域具有广泛的应用。

1、优势:

(1)模块化设计:OpenStack采用模块化设计,便于扩展和定制。

(2)跨平台支持:OpenStack支持主流云平台,如阿里云、腾讯云、华为云等。

(3)开源生态:OpenStack拥有庞大的开源社区,提供丰富的解决方案。

多云管理开源软件有哪些平台,开源视角,盘点多云管理领域的明星平台及解决方案

图片来源于网络,如有侵权联系删除

2、特点:

(1)基础设施即服务(IaaS):OpenStack提供基础设施即服务,包括计算、网络和存储。

(2)自动化部署:OpenStack支持自动化部署和管理,降低运维成本。

(3)高可用性:OpenStack具备高可用性,保障业务连续性。

Terraform

Terraform是HashiCorp公司推出的开源基础设施即代码(IaC)工具,旨在简化多云基础设施的部署和管理,Terraform在多云管理领域具有广泛应用。

1、优势:

(1)基础设施即代码:Terraform使用代码定义基础设施,提高管理效率。

(2)跨平台支持:Terraform支持主流云平台,如阿里云、腾讯云、华为云等。

(3)自动化部署:Terraform支持自动化部署和管理,降低运维成本。

2、特点:

(1)声明式配置:Terraform使用声明式配置,易于理解和维护。

(2)版本控制:Terraform支持版本控制,便于追踪和管理变更。

(3)资源管理:Terraform提供丰富的资源管理功能,如网络、存储、数据库等。

多云管理开源软件有哪些平台,开源视角,盘点多云管理领域的明星平台及解决方案

图片来源于网络,如有侵权联系删除

Ansible

Ansible是Red Hat公司推出的开源自动化工具,旨在实现自动化部署、配置和运维,Ansible在多云管理领域具有广泛应用。

1、优势:

(1)自动化部署:Ansible支持自动化部署,降低运维成本。

(2)简单易用:Ansible使用YAML语言编写自动化脚本,易于学习和使用。

(3)跨平台支持:Ansible支持主流云平台,如阿里云、腾讯云、华为云等。

2、特点:

(1)模块化设计:Ansible采用模块化设计,便于扩展和定制。

(2)幂等性:Ansible支持幂等性,避免重复执行导致的问题。

(3)自动化运维:Ansible提供自动化运维功能,如监控、日志管理等。

多云管理开源软件在数字化转型过程中发挥着重要作用,本文盘点了Kubernetes、OpenStack、Terraform和Ansible等开源平台,分析了它们的优势与特点,企业可以根据自身需求选择合适的开源软件,实现多云管理目标。

标签: #多云管理开源软件有哪些

黑狐家游戏
  • 评论列表

留言评论